Panama's Digital Architecture: A Strategic Gateway for Connectivity

Panama occupies a highly unique geographical and strategic position. Functioning as the "Hub de las Américas," the country is not only a conduit for global physical trade through the Panama Canal but has rapidly emerged as the primary digital and telecommunications hub for Central and South America. With multiple submarine fiber optic cables landing on its shores (such as ARCOS-1, SAC, Maya-1, and PAC), Panama acts as a low-latency gateway routing massive data traffic between North America, South America, and the Caribbean.

Panama Networking Reality: To support this digital crossroad, modern data centers (including operations in the Panama Pacifico area and Panama City's banking centers) demand high-performance layer-3 network switches, redundant high-throughput network adapters (HBAs), and resilient rack servers that can sustain high transaction volumes without interruption.

Climatic and Technical Demands for Network Hardware in Panama

Deploying networking infrastructure in Panama comes with specific environmental and technical demands that global suppliers must address:

  • High Humidity and Saline Mitigation: Panama's tropical climate and proximity to two oceans introduce high relative humidity and salt-laden air. Network switches and server chassis deployed in local edge environments require robust corrosion-resistant PCB coating and high-quality cooling fans.
  • Power Grid Fluctuations: While Panama's metropolitan infrastructure is advanced, rural and port edge nodes often encounter power inconsistencies. Hot-swappable, redundant power supplies are critical features for switches and servers operating in these zones.
  • Multilingual Management and Global Support: Enterprise customers in Panama demand configuration support in both Spanish and English, alongside strong SLA commitments for replacement components.

Global Networking Trends: AI Co-location and Optical Evolution

The global networking landscape is currently driven by the exponential growth of artificial intelligence (AI) and cloud computing workloads. Key trends shaping network hardware manufacturing include:

  • The Shift to 400G/800G: Data center spine-and-leaf network switches are migrating rapidly to support higher bandwidth speeds to mitigate bottlenecks in high-density GPU computing clusters.
  • Zero-Trust Hardware Security: Modern network switches integrate MACsec encryption directly onto ports, ensuring data in transit between remote office networks is secured at the hardware layer.
  • Eco-Friendly Power Metrics: With global regulatory focus on carbon reduction, network switches must utilize smart energy-saving chipsets that dynamically adjust power intake based on traffic loads.

Network Switch Technology Roadmap for Panama Infrastructure

A reference architecture mapping layer-2 access configurations up to high-speed layer-3 backbone links in coastal enterprise nodes.

Deployment Tier Recommended Architecture Key Interface Parameters Optimal Local Scenarios
Access Layer (Port Edge) Layer 2 Switch with PoE+ & SFP uplinks 1G/10G RJ45 Base-T + 10G SFP+ uplinks Colón warehousing IP surveillance, port office LANs
Aggregation Layer Layer 3 Switch with multi-chassis link aggregation (MLAG) 10G SFP+ / 40G QSFP+ transceivers Panama Pacifico corporate HQ campuses, regional offices
Core Routing & Backbone High-Performance Non-blocking L3 Switch Chassis 40G QSFP+ / 100G QSFP28 core links Panama City Banking Center, Multi-tenant Data Centers

Implementing a proper three-tiered networking model ensures network failures are confined to specific broadcast domains, minimizing downtime in critical logistics channels. Dynamic routing protocols like OSPF and BGP are recommended for core aggregation nodes to allow automated route convergence in case of line disruptions along sea-crossing fiber bridges.
